Russia and China have announced they will deepen their already close military ties, as Vladimir Putin made his first visit to China after sweeping the elections back home. Meanwhile, after months of negotiations, Dutch ultranationalist Geert Wilders and his coalition partners have struck a deal to form the government. In the US, Vice President Kamala Harris has urged more Indian-Americans to take part in the electoral process saying the community's representation in the government was not reflective of its growing population.
